Head-to-Head Comparison

Scavio vs You.com API

You.com rebranded around its Search API and Agent API in 2025 as teams started treating agents as a primary distribution surface. Scavio takes a different angle: one API covers Google SERP, Reddit discussions, YouTube transcripts, Amazon, and Walmart. Both target agent developers. The choice comes down to whether your agent actually needs non-web data.

Verdict

You.com is the right call if your agent is a pure web research bot and you want pre-synthesized answers. Scavio is the right call for anything that touches discussion, video, or shopping data (the majority of real agent use cases). Per-credit economics also favor Scavio at any meaningful volume.
